Event Series | „The Art of Society 1900–1945: The Nationalgalerie Collection

On the occasion of the exhibition "The Art of Society" at the Neue Nationalgalerie, a monthly series of events from September 2022 to July 2023 will discuss social processes of a turbulent time: the German Empire, colonial history, the First World War, the "Golden" Twenties, National Socialism as well as the Second World War and the Holocaust. Based on works by Max Ernst, Emil Nolde and Irma Stern, among others, art historians, artists, writers and experts from other disciplines will build a bridge from the historical exhibition to the here and now in lectures and discussions. Topics such as war, political extremism, poverty, feminism, and interculturalism are of current relevance for today's society.

The events will take place from September 2022 to June 2023, on the first Wednesday of each month at 7 pm. Admission is free. Afterwards, the exhibition can be visited until 10 pm.

The event series is made possible by the Ferdinand-Möller-Stiftung, Berlin.
